Breaking the Code Myth: Navigating UX/UI Careers Without a Programming Background

Traditionally, UX/UI designers were expected to have a comprehensive understanding of coding languages. However, the landscape has evolved, and contemporary design tools have made coding skills less of a necessity. The focus has shifted towards collaboration between designers and developers, fostering a more inclusive and interdisciplinary work environment.

Why Coding Knowledge Was Once Emphasized:

  1. Communication with Developers:
  • In the past, coding knowledge was deemed essential for effective communication with developers. Designers needed to articulate their vision in a language that developers could seamlessly translate into functional interfaces.
  1. Prototyping and Implementation:
  • Understanding code facilitated the creation of interactive prototypes and the implementation of design concepts. This hands-on approach allowed designers to bring their visions to life independently.

The Contemporary Landscape:

  1. Design Tools Empower Creativity:
  • Modern design tools like Figma, Sketch, and Adobe XD have revolutionized the design process. These tools offer intuitive interfaces, allowing designers to create intricate and interactive designs without delving into code.
  1. Collaboration is Key:
  • The emphasis is now on collaboration between designers and developers. While designers focus on crafting seamless user experiences, developers bring these designs to fruition. This collaborative approach fosters a more efficient workflow, leveraging the strengths of both disciplines.
  1. Diverse Skill Sets:
  • UX/UI design is a multifaceted field that values a diverse set of skills. While coding can be beneficial, it is not a prerequisite. Creativity, empathy, problem-solving, and a keen understanding of user behavior are equally—if not more—important skills for a successful career in UX/UI design.

How to Thrive Without Coding Knowledge:

  1. Master Design Tools:
  • Invest time in mastering design tools. Understanding the capabilities of tools like Figma or Sketch enables you to create visually stunning and interactive designs.
  1. Focus on Core Design Principles:
  • Strengthen your foundation in design principles such as hierarchy, color theory, and typography. These fundamental skills are the building blocks of impactful and user-friendly designs.
  1. Embrace Collaboration:
  • Foster strong collaborative relationships with developers. Effective communication and a shared understanding of design goals can bridge the gap between design and development.

In the dynamic landscape of UX/UI design, coding is not a mandatory prerequisite for success. While coding knowledge can be advantageous, the evolution of design tools and the emphasis on collaboration have reshaped the expectations for designers.

If you have a passion for creating seamless and delightful user experiences, armed with a creative mindset and a willingness to collaborate, a rewarding career in UX/UI design awaits you—no coding required.

3 Likes